16th InvisiYouth Chat Sessions: Audio Flash Files gives you a boost of life advice and perspectives that’ll provide empowering tools you can practically incorporate into your life for more success and joy.
We’re focusing in on the relationship and communication with the general public. So many times, we encounter those instances when random people will ask us questions or make comments, especially about chronic illness/disability, so knowing how to react with confidence creates success. 
While it might seem odd to focus on communication mediator advice for the dynamic with the general public, it’s important to remember it’s the group of people that’s fleeting, evolves, and is everywhere you go. So it is important to sharpen your communication with this dynamic.

This podcast episode brings to the forefront why it is so vital to understand how to encounter communicating with the general public, and why those experiences can impact us deeply.  And the reasoning behind our reactions to their commentary holds more value than what is actually said because it allows us to know where our confidence stems from about ourselves, and what to tap into when our insecurities are touched upon by random people. 

We teach you all about the Inner Litmus Test Method and what you need to know about mental and reactive litmus tests in order to know why having an inner test to know how you feel about something or someone can lead to your success. We give all the steps about how to instantaneously react when the general public gives you that question or comment that stops you in your tracks, how to check your wellbeing and how full your cup or handling others with verbal education truly is, and when to dip in your metaphorical litmus test to see if it’s positive or negative and how to proceed with either result.

Plus, founder Dominique spills the tea on the two instances she was using her cane and had public questions so she had to pull out her own litmus tests with two different reactions, so you’ll see how to communicate with confidence in both instances.
